State legislations regulate the level of darkness allowed for auto glass tinting. Home window color laws are created as a safety and security issue for motorists to see various other automobiles better when driving and for police police officers as they come close to a vehicle. When identifying just how much to tint windows, you must inspect your state's department of automobile to find out about the guidelines, such as the lawful visible light transmission (VLT) levels.

The 7-Second Trick For Speedefx



State legislations specify the level of tint permitted each window of passenger vehicles. All states have constraints on tinting related to front windscreens. Many states limit the quantity of tint on a car's windshield or front side home windows. Seven states (Alaska, California, Delaware, Iowa, New York,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island) and the Area of Columbia need 70% light transmission on colored home windows.

State laws might transform each year. Respectable home window tinting companies worked with to mount aftermarket color film will be acquainted with the policies in your area. Your compliance with the legislation for car home window tinting might alter if you relocate to another state. Numerous states supply car window tinting exemptions for motorists with a reputable clinical or vision-related demand to restrict their exposure to sunshine.

Automotive home window tinting is a popular choice for motorists that intend to personalize their cars and trucks. Companies that focus on tinting cars and truck windows are most likely near you. Automobile detail stores and some dealership service facilities typically give tint installation services. A typical inquiry asked by people curious about dark glass is exactly how much does it cost to tint vehicle windows.

In extremely basic terms, and depending on the quality and functions of the material made use of, auto window tinting prices for a sedan can be $200 to $500.

Don't assume that a higher cost means much better top quality. Visit stores face to face to get quotes. Consider the tidiness of the workplace, take a look at the work they're dealing with, and request for references. A credible color store will happily reveal you its work and have previous clients share their experiences.
